<p>Art direction &amp; design of the 2009 promotional book for the largest hand-paint advertising company in the United States.</p>
<p><a rel="nofollow" href="http://colossalmedia.com/" target="_blank">Colossal Media</a> is an innovative Out Of Home company that specializes in high-impact painted wallscapes. <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.ghava.com" target="_blank">GHAVA</a> worked closely with cofounders Paul Lindahl and Adrian Moeller to deliver an engaging leave-behind sales tool that offers deeper insight into their business in a personalized manner.</p>
<p>The book contains behind the scenes imagery, overviews of services, as well as in-depth case studies for some of their more noteworthy projects including <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.banksy.co.uk/" target="_blank">Banksy&#8217;s</a> large scale murals in NYC and The New York Public Art Fund commissioned 19,744 square foot installation of artist <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.publicartfund.org/pafweb/projects/06/morris/morris-06.html" target="_blank">Sarah Morris&#8217;s</a> work on the ceiling of the <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.leverhouse.com/" target="_blank">Lever House</a>, a NYC landmark building.</p>
<p>Photography by Morgan Howland, Stephen Schuster, Ray Mock, and Colossal Media.</p>
